Set a Budget (and Then Add 20%)
You can’t plan a complete home improvement on a napkin. You need a budget that’s real.
Talk to contractors early. Prices change. Materials fluctuate. And yeah, there will be surprises. Always.
Add at least 10–20% for the unexpected—because something always comes up.

What Makes a Great Contractor?
- Licensed and insured (non-negotiable).
- Transparent with pricing.
- Communicates clearly and often.
- Has proven experience with home remodeling services and big projects.

Choose Materials That Last
- Quartz countertops (gorgeous, low-maintenance).
- Hardwood or LVP floors (durable, timeless).
- Porcelain tiles (waterproof and easy to clean).
Sure, marble looks beautiful… until you spill wine on it.

Step 5: Room-by-Room Tips
Kitchen
Go for storage first, looks second.
A well-designed kitchen saves you time every day.
Add under-cabinet lighting—it changes everything.
Bathroom
Low-maintenance wins.
Pick tile that hides water spots. Add ventilation. Maybe heated floors if you’re feeling fancy.
Living Room
Light. Always light. Open up walls, play with mirrors, use natural tones.
You want comfort and calm.
Outdoor Space
Decks, patios, pergolas—whatever adds to your lifestyle.
It’s not just a backyard—it’s another living area waiting to happen.
